• In the ever-evolving landscape of virtual reality (VR), the demand for high-quality imaging solutions has skyrocketed. As VR applications continue to permeate various industries, from gaming and entertainment to healthcare and education, the need for immersive visual experiences has become paramount. This is where industrial USB cameras equipped with High Dynamic Range (HDR) technology step in to revolutionize the VR landscape.

    HDR USB cameras represent a significant advancement in imaging technology, offering unparalleled image quality and dynamic range. Traditional cameras often struggle to capture scenes with high contrast, resulting in overexposed highlights and underexposed shadows. However, HDR cameras excel in capturing a wider range of luminance levels, reproducing details in both bright and dark areas with remarkable fidelity.

    One of the key benefits of HDR USB cameras is their ability to enhance the realism and immersion of virtual reality environments. Whether it's a virtual tour of a real-world location, a training simulation in a hazardous environment, or an interactive gaming experience, HDR cameras ensure that every detail is faithfully rendered, transporting users into a lifelike digital realm.

    Moreover, industrial-grade USB cameras offer robustness and reliability, making them ideal for demanding VR applications in fields such as automotive design, architecture, and industrial training. With features like precise exposure control, high frame rates, and low latency, HDR USB cameras deliver smooth and responsive visuals, crucial for a seamless VR experience.

    In the realm of virtual reality, achieving presence—the feeling of actually being in a virtual environment—is paramount. HDR USB cameras play a pivotal role in creating this sense of presence by capturing scenes with unparalleled clarity and realism. Whether it's the subtle nuances of lighting and shadow or the vibrant colors of a virtual world, HDR cameras ensure that every detail contributes to a truly immersive experience.

    Furthermore, HDR technology isn't just limited to visual fidelity; it also enhances the overall comfort and safety of VR experiences. By accurately capturing lighting conditions and minimizing visual artifacts, HDR cameras help reduce eye strain and fatigue, allowing users to engage in VR experiences for extended periods without discomfort.

    In addition to their role in VR, HDR USB cameras find applications in various other fields, including video conferencing, telemedicine, and remote monitoring. The versatility and performance of these cameras make them indispensable tools for capturing and transmitting high-quality imagery in real-time, regardless of the application.

  • In the realm of modern agriculture, technology plays an increasingly vital role in enhancing efficiency and productivity. One of the most revolutionary advancements in recent years has been the integration of compact embedded cameras into agricultural drones. These small yet powerful cameras have transformed farming practices, offering farmers unprecedented insights into their crops and land. In this blog post, we'll delve into the significance of embedded cameras for agricultural drones and how they are reshaping the landscape of farming.

    Agricultural drones equipped with embedded cameras are rapidly gaining popularity due to their ability to capture high-resolution imagery of farmland from aerial perspectives. These compact cameras are designed to be lightweight and durable, making them ideal for mounting on drones that navigate through various terrains and weather conditions. Their small size allows for seamless integration into the drone's structure, minimizing aerodynamic drag and ensuring optimal flight performance.

    One of the primary applications of embedded cameras in agricultural drones is crop monitoring and analysis. By capturing detailed images of crops at different growth stages, farmers can gain valuable insights into their health, growth patterns, and potential issues such as pest infestations or nutrient deficiencies. This data enables farmers to make informed decisions regarding irrigation, fertilization, and pest control, ultimately leading to higher yields and healthier crops.

    Moreover, embedded cameras equipped with advanced imaging technologies, such as multispectral and thermal sensors, offer even greater capabilities for agricultural monitoring. Multispectral cameras can capture images across multiple wavelengths of light, allowing farmers to analyze plant health indicators invisible to the naked eye, such as chlorophyll levels and water stress. Thermal cameras, on the other hand, detect heat signatures emitted by crops, which can be used to identify areas of stress, assess water distribution, and even detect crop diseases.

    Another significant advantage of embedded cameras for agricultural drones is their ability to generate precise and georeferenced data. By integrating GPS technology with the camera systems, drones can capture images with accurate location metadata, enabling farmers to create detailed maps of their fields and precisely target areas for intervention. This spatially referenced data enhances the efficiency of farming operations, allowing for precise application of resources and minimizing waste.

    Furthermore, embedded cameras facilitate the implementation of precision agriculture techniques, such as variable rate application and site-specific management. By analyzing the imagery captured by drones, farmers can identify variability within their fields and adjust inputs accordingly to optimize yield and minimize environmental impact. For example, areas with higher nutrient levels may require reduced fertilizer application, while areas with pest infestations may require targeted pesticide treatment.

    In addition to crop monitoring, embedded cameras in agricultural drones are also valuable tools for environmental monitoring and land management. They can be used to assess soil erosion, monitor water resources, and even track the growth of vegetation in conservation areas. This data aids in sustainable land use planning and helps farmers minimize their ecological footprint while maximizing productivity.

  • Embedded cameras, with their compact size and powerful capabilities, are transforming the retail landscape by providing unprecedented insights into customer behavior, inventory management, and store operations. These sophisticated devices, often discreetly integrated into retail environments, capture valuable data in real-time, enabling retailers to make informed decisions quickly and effectively.

    One of the key areas where embedded cameras are making a significant impact is in the realm of customer analytics. By strategically placing cameras throughout retail spaces, businesses can gather valuable information about customer demographics, traffic patterns, and behavior. This data allows retailers to optimize store layouts, improve product placement, and enhance the overall shopping experience for customers.

    Moreover, embedded cameras play a crucial role in inventory management, helping retailers streamline operations and reduce costs. By employing advanced image recognition technology, these cameras can accurately track inventory levels, detect out-of-stock items, and even monitor shelf replenishment in real-time. This level of automation not only minimizes manual intervention but also ensures that shelves are always stocked, leading to increased sales and customer satisfaction.

    Furthermore, embedded cameras are empowering retailers to enhance security and mitigate loss prevention challenges. With features such as facial recognition and video surveillance, these cameras can identify suspicious behavior, deter theft, and provide invaluable evidence in the event of incidents. By proactively monitoring stores and warehouses, retailers can safeguard their assets and minimize losses, thereby improving overall profitability.

    In addition to their operational benefits, embedded cameras are also driving innovation in customer engagement and marketing strategies. By analyzing customer interactions and preferences captured by these cameras, retailers can personalize marketing campaigns, tailor promotions, and offer targeted recommendations. This personalized approach not only increases customer loyalty but also drives sales and revenue growth.

    The adoption of embedded cameras in retail is not without its challenges, however. Concerns surrounding privacy, data security, and ethical implications must be carefully addressed to ensure compliance with regulations and maintain consumer trust. Retailers must prioritize transparency and accountability in their use of camera technology, establishing clear policies and protocols to protect customer privacy and data integrity.

    Despite these challenges, the potential benefits of embedded cameras in retail automation are undeniable. By harnessing the power of these advanced devices, retailers can optimize operations, improve customer experiences, and drive business growth in an increasingly competitive market landscape. As technology continues to evolve, embedded cameras will undoubtedly remain at the forefront of retail innovation, shaping the future of the industry for years to come.

    Market Overview:
    Computer vision technology is a branch of machine learning and artificial intelligence that aims to understand the content of digital images. Computer vision technology is extremely useful and has been adopted by a wide range of industrial sectors, including manufacturing, healthcare, defence, and security. This market is still in its early stages, but due to the benefits associated with the technology, it is expected to have a massive opportunity in the future. Deep learning, neural networks, machine learning, and other fields all use computer vision in collaboration. Other applications include gesture analysis, image restoration, facial recognition, and others.
